/* Exec SHELL, or DEFAULT_SHELL if SHELL is "" or NULL.
 | 
						|
 * If ADDITIONAL_ARGS is not NULL, pass them to the shell.
 | 
						|
 */
 | 
						|
void FAST_FUNC exec_shell(const char *shell, int loginshell, const char **additional_args)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
	const char **args;
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
	args = additional_args;
 | 
						|
	while (args && *args)
 | 
						|
		args++;
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
	args = xzalloc(sizeof(args[0]) * (2 + (args - additional_args)));
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
	if (!shell || !shell[0])
 | 
						|
		shell = DEFAULT_SHELL;
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
	args[0] = bb_get_last_path_component_nostrip(shell);
 | 
						|
	if (loginshell)
 | 
						|
		args[0] = xasprintf("-%s", args[0]);
 | 
						|
	/*args[1] = NULL; - already is */
 | 
						|
	if (additional_args) {
 | 
						|
		int cnt = 0;
 | 
						|
		while (*additional_args)
 | 
						|
			args[++cnt] = *additional_args++;
 | 
						|
	}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
#if ENABLE_SELINUX
 | 
						|
	if (current_sid)
 | 
						|
		setexeccon(current_sid);
 | 
						|
	if (ENABLE_FEATURE_CLEAN_UP)
 | 
						|
		freecon(current_sid);
 | 
						|
#endif
 | 
						|
	execv(shell, (char **) args);
 | 
						|
	bb_perror_msg_and_die("can't execute '%s'", shell);
 | 
						|
}
